PDA

View Full Version : چک کردن پایان کار thread



Alfred188
دوشنبه 20 آذر 1391, 10:40 صبح
سلام،
من تو یه برنامه از thread استفاده می کنم و می خوام بعد از پایان کار thread یه کار دیگه انجام بدم یا حد اقل یه پیام که بگه کار تمومه.
چطوری باید متوجه بشم کارش تموم شده؟
البته چندتا مورد پیدا کردم که با استفاده از سشن و تایمر بود که تایمر مرتب یه سشن رو چک می کرد که تو چه وضعیتی هست. به نظرتون منم باید همین کارو انجام بدم یا راه بهتری هم هست؟

samira3
دوشنبه 20 آذر 1391, 11:05 صبح
سلام
بنظرم اونجا كه threas،شروع مي كنيد زير خطش كد بزنيد تا اونجا كه يادم براي اجرايي thread بايد يك دستور

samira3
دوشنبه 20 آذر 1391, 11:11 صبح
t.start();
كد پيغام بزن و... تست كن خبر بده جواب داد يا نه.

Alfred188
دوشنبه 20 آذر 1391, 14:12 عصر
ببخشید من با خود thread مشکلی ندارم، درست اجرا می شه و نتیجه هم می ده ولی برای اطلاع کاربر از پایان کارش دنبال چاره هستم
از join استفاده کردم ولی خوب باز به دردم نمی خوره چون برنامه تا thread تموم نشده کاره دیگه ای انجام نمی ده!